ScoutSouth.com: ACA vs. Highland Home
This story originally published on
ScoutSouth.com
American Christian Quarterback Brad Smelley
By
Chris Shelton
ScoutSouth.com
Posted Nov 15, 2007
|
More
High school football has reached the second round of the Alabama State Playoffs this week. An important battle in 2A features the American Christian Patriots (9-2, 7-0) and the Highland Home Flying Squadron (9-2, 5-2).
American Christian is led by
Alabama
commitment and quarterback
Brad Smelley
. Smelley averages over 232 yards per game for Coach Stephen Hooks and the Patriots. His offense averages about 42 points per game and more than 300 yards.
They will be tough to stop for Coach Bob Farrior’s Flying Squadron. “I expect them to do what they have done all year long. They have a balanced offense, about 50/50. They are extremely well coached and very intelligent. I expect a tough game,” Farrior said Wednesday afternoon.
With a Squadron defense that allows 26 points per game, guys like
Leo McCoy, Rico Harris,
and
Kelan Grace
will have to step up.
Highland Home has a tough task on offense as well. The Patriots only give up 15 points per game.
When asked about some playmakers on his offense, Farrior said, “We have quite a few. We have pretty good depth at our skill positions.
Deymond Sankey
is a real good quarterback, and he has a good backup in
Rico Harris."
"We have two really good wide receivers,
Darius Chambers
and
Kelan Grace."
Those guys will have to step up for the Squadron and Farrior said penalties cannot lose the game.
“We have out-gained every opponent this year, but we have been hurt by penalties. We can’t let that happen," he said.
